VECTOR PCX SPECIFICATIONS
•
Dimensions: (h x w x d): 43 x 21.6 x
41.2 cm (17 x 8.75 x 16 inches)
•
Weight: 11.5 kg (25.3 lb.)
•
Electrical: 100 - 120V, 50/60 Hz 1.7 A,
200 W or 200-240 V, 50/60 Hz, 0.8 A,
200W Mains voltage ± 10% of nominal
Installation (overvoltage) category II,
pollution degree 2
REAGENT PUMPS
•
Independently adjustable, low-pulsation
•
Adjustable from 0.05 to 2.00 mL/minute
against back- pressures of up to 2000 psi
•
Flow Accuracy 3% for flowrates of
0.33 ml/min and above, 0.01 ml/min
for flowrates below 0.33 ml/min
•
Flow Precision 0.5% RSD
•
Sapphire pistons
•
Liquid ends; including check valve
housing PEEK
•
PEEK Bypass/purge valves for each
pump located on front of instrument panel
•
Automatic Piston wash
FLOW PATH
•
Independent pressure transducer
for each pump 210 bar (0-3000 psi)
•
Diamond-packed restrictors, match
to flow rate and viscosity of reagents
•
PEEK Bypass/purge valves
•
Replaceable reagent filter
•
PEEK mixing manifold
REACTOR
•
Heater reactor controls at ±0.4° C for
temperatures from 10° C above ambient
to 130° C. Range of reactor dwell
volumes, depending upon application
•
Reaction coil withstands up to 42 bar
(600 psi) inlet pressure at 130° C
• LCD
display of actual temperature or s
et point
•
Thermal safety switch limits temperature
to 150°C |
GAS PRESSURE MANIFOLD AND REGULATOR
•
Regulator maintains 0.3 bar (3-5 psi) on
reagent reservoirs with 3-5 bar
(45-75 psi) source pressure
•
Pressure-relief valve opens at 0.7
bar (10 psi)
•
Manifold has two 1/4-28
tubing connections
• Gas
line with anti siphon valve
PRESSURIZED REAGENT RESERVOIR
• One
liter capacity (2 and 5 L
reservoirs available)
•
Maintained under inert gas pressure to
inhibit oxidation of OPA or other oxygen-
sensitive reagents
•
Valve built into reservoir cap permits
sparging during reagent preparation
•
Reagent reservoirs fitted with 3.1 mm
OD oxygen-impermeable Saran tubing
for oxygen-sensitive reagents and/or
with 3.1 mm OD FEP tubing.
•
Check-values on the gas lines prevents
back-flow of the reagent into the manifold
in case of pressure drop.
SAFEGUARDS TO PREVENT:
•
Post-column Reagent Backflow
A pressure switch installed between LC (eluant)
pump and sample injector turns off power
to reagent pumps and reactor when the
eluant pump pressure drops to 35 bar (500
psi), ensuring that reagent will not flow
upstream and damage the analytical column.
Low eluant pressure can result from power
failure, eluant pump malfunction,
automatic or intentional shut-down, or an
empty reservoir. The Vector PCX will not
restart automatically.
•
Post-column system over-pressure
A relief valve pre-calibrated to open at
35 bar (500 psi) prevents rupture of the
post-column reactor tubing in the event of
downstream blockage, and reduces the
possibility that all or part of the
reagent flow will be diverted to the
column
